  1. Tibetan jewelry is particularly rich, and due to the different regions, the jewelry style is also large. In simple terms, Tibetan accessories include headdress, earrings, bracelets, rings, necklaces, Gawu (Buddha), belt, milk hook, needle box box, etc. Metals are mostly gold and silver, jewelry mainly includes red coral, turquoise, amber, amber, amber, amber, amber, amber, amber, amber, amber, amber, amber, amber Beeswax, ivory, agate, etc. From Tibetan clothing, you can see Tibetan history, culture, and religious beliefs. Most of the silver jewelry of the belt is double dragon grabbing pattern and vomiting mouse patterns. The tangled patterns and life characters are also common, which means auspicious. Tibetan eight treasure maps (treasure umbrella, victory building, treasure bottle, goldfish, conch, lotus, auspicious net, golden wheel) appear in the ornaments alone or in combination, reflecting the religious beliefs of the Tibetan nation. Shellfish and silver dollars are used as accessories, which reflect the historical changes of currencies in Tibetan history. Tibetans are nomadic peoples. Women also wear all their families on their bodies. Saddle -style gold and silver rings, silver or copper hooks, needle boxes, etc. are a manifestation of living tools that slowly evolve into decorations. The above is just a rough understanding.
